Jacobsen, Frank – Journal of Employment Counseling, 1977
Results of the current study of 1976 data indicate that although the advantage in favor of counseled applicants being placed was somewhat less in fiscal year 1976 than in fiscal year 1973, counseled applicants' percentage-of-placement rate was still higher than that for all applicants in general. Prediger, Dale J. – Vocational Guidance Quarterly, 1981
Studied job analysis ratings for 12,009 occupations listed in the Fourth Edition "Dictionary of Occupational Titles" as supporting two bipolar work task dimensions: working with data versus ideas; and working with things versus people. Discusses everyday vocational guidance applications. (RC)
